Understanding Mobile Phone Radiation
Mobile phone radiation is a form of electromagnetic radiation that is emitted by mobile devices during their operation. This radiation is commonly referred to as radiofrequency (RF) radiation.
These RF waves are non-ionizing, meaning they do not possess enough energy to directly damage the DNA of living cells, as ionizing radiation (such as X-rays) does.

1. Heating Effects
One of the primary concerns associated with mobile phone radiation is its ability to generate heat when absorbed by the body. The Specific Absorption Rate (SAR) measures the rate at which RF energy is absorbed by the body.
The heat generated by mobile phones can lead to local tissue heating in areas of the body that are in close proximity to the device, such as the ear or brain.
2. Possible Cancer Risk
There has been extensive research exploring the potential link between mobile phone radiation and the development of cancer.
The World Health Organization’s International Agency for Research on Cancer (IARC) has classified mobile phone radiation as a possible carcinogen, based on limited evidence suggesting a potential association with glioma, a type of brain cancer.

6. Electromagnetic Hypersensitivity
Electromagnetic hypersensitivity (EHS) is a condition in which individuals claim to experience various symptoms when exposed to electromagnetic fields, including those emitted by mobile phones.
However, scientific studies have failed to establish a clear causal relationship between mobile phone radiation and the reported symptoms.

8. Minimizing Exposure
While the research surrounding mobile phone radiation is continuing to evolve, individuals can take certain measures to reduce their exposure. These include:.
– Using hands-free devices, such as Bluetooth headsets or speakerphone mode.
– Keeping the phone away from the body, by using a belt clip or phone stand.
– Reducing phone usage in areas with a weak signal, as phones emit more radiation in such situations to establish a connection.
– Limiting screen time before bed to maintain healthy sleep patterns.
